What Bitcoin Isn’t

Moneyweb, Paul Donovan
UBS and other banks, even some central banks, have adopted blockchain technology that speeds up transactions between the major banks of the world. But you need to separate the underlying technology, which is rather dull, from bitcoin itself, which might be exciting, but it’s not an actual currency.

On 2017-09-11, Paul Donovan (Economist) declared Bitcoin dead via Moneyweb. Bitcoin was trading at ~$4,189 at the time. The call joins the growing canon of premature obituaries.

The declaration was catalogued on September 11, 2017, when one Bitcoin traded for approximately $4,189. Since then, Bitcoin has appreciated by 17.5× relative to the price on the day Moneyweb pronounced it finished.
